Joint action: bodies and minds moving together.

Natalie Sebanz1, Harold Bekkering, Günther Knoblich

  • 1Rutgers, The State University of New Jersey, Psychology Department, Smith Hall, 101 Warren Street, Newark, NJ 07102, USA. sebanz@psychology.rutgers.edu

Trends in Cognitive Sciences
|January 13, 2006
PubMed
Summary

Coordinating actions with others is vital for human success. Recent research on joint action, focusing on social contexts, reveals key cognitive and neural mechanisms for shared representations and action prediction.

Area of Science:

  • Cognitive Neuroscience
  • Social Psychology
  • Neuroscience

Background:

  • Understanding joint action is crucial for human success.
  • Traditional cognitive neuroscience has focused on individual cognition, limiting progress in joint action research.
  • Recent advances investigate perception and action within social contexts.

Purpose of the Study:

  • To outline how studies on joint attention, action observation, task sharing, action coordination, and agency advance the understanding of joint action.
  • To propose mechanisms supporting shared representations, action prediction, and integration of action effects.

Main Methods:

  • Review of studies on joint attention and action observation.
  • Analysis of research on task sharing and action coordination.

  • Examination of studies on agency in social contexts.
  • Main Results:

    • Joint action research is progressing by studying social contexts.
    • Several mechanisms facilitate joint action, including shared representations and action prediction.
    • Integration of predicted effects from own and others' actions is key.

    Conclusions:

    • Investigating joint action in social contexts is essential for understanding human cooperation.
    • Proposed mechanisms provide a framework for future research on the cognitive and neural basis of joint action.
    • This work highlights the importance of social interaction for cognitive and neural processes.
